North Star stacked an eighth blowout win onto their ever-increasing hoard on Friday. They blew past the Ferndale Yellow Jackets 15-1. Winning may never get old, but North Star sure is getting used to it with their third in a row.
Connor Yoder was excellent, going 1-for-2 with a home run. The team also got some help courtesy of Andy Retassie, who scored three runs while going 1-for-2.
On Ferndale's side, they saw two different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Joe Prave, who scored a run and stole a base while going 1-for-2.
North Star's win was their fifth stra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 10-2. As for Ferndale,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-11.
